Cotton is one of the most significant applications for Reactive Red 76, primarily due to the fiber's absorbent properties and compatibility with reactive dyes. Cotton fabrics, which are widely used in the textile industry for everything from casual wear to home furnishings, require dyes that bond well with their cellulose structure. Reactive Red 76 provides a bright, durable color that enhances the fabric's aesthetic appeal. The cotton subsegment has witnessed steady growth, fueled by rising consumer demand for high-quality, vibrant cotton textiles in various sectors, including apparel, home textiles, and medical textiles. The robust growth of the fashion industry, coupled with the increasing demand for organic cotton and eco-friendly textile products, is expected to continue driving the need for dyes like Reactive Red 76. Furthermore, the emphasis on sustainable and low-impact dyeing processes is creating opportunities for Reactive Red 76 to meet these environmental demands through improved formulations and methods. As consumer preferences shift towards more sustainable textiles, the cotton segment will continue to remain a key player in the overall market landscape for Reactive Red 76.
